Market Summary

This market centers on the head-to-head match result between Osasuna and FC Barcelona, scheduled for May 2, 2026, at 19:00 UTC, as part of Matchday 34 of the 2025/26 La Liga season. La Liga is one of Europe's premier football competitions, where late-season fixtures carry direct implications for title contention, European qualification, and relegation battles as clubs finalize their standings in the closing weeks of the campaign. Traders are assessing Barcelona's title aspirations, Osasuna's home form at El Sadar, recent head-to-head results, squad availability, and tactical setups to evaluate the probability of either side winning or the match ending in a draw.

Rules

1. Market Outcomes and Resolution Criteria: The market resolves YES if FC Barcelona score more goals than Osasuna at full time; it resolves NO if Osasuna win or the match ends in a draw. There is no TIE outcome; the market resolves only to YES or NO.

2. Definition of "Win": For resolution purposes, "win" means FC Barcelona hold a higher goal count than Osasuna at the conclusion of 90 minutes of regulation play, including referee-added stoppage time. This is a La Liga fixture — extra time and penalties do not apply. Own goals count toward the opposing team's score.

3. Official Sources and Evidence: The primary source is the official La Liga website (laliga.com) for the official match result. ESPN, BBC Sport and Sofascore may be used as secondary sources for corroboration only.

4. Resolution Timing: The market is reviewed upon confirmation of the full-time result. It resolves no sooner than 3 hours after the official full-time result is confirmed on the primary source. If the match is delayed from the scheduled 19:00 UTC kick-off but commences on the same calendar date (May 2, 2026), the result still governs resolution.

5. Handling Postponements and Cancellations: If the match is postponed, suspended, cancelled, or abandoned and no eligible result is confirmed within 12 hours of the scheduled kick-off, the market resolves Tie at $0.50 per share. If the match is abandoned mid-game and later officially resumed to completion, the final official 90-minute result governs. Partial scores from an abandoned match are not used for resolution.

6. Ambiguities and Disputes: In cases of conflicting results between sources, the official La Liga published result (laliga.com) takes precedence over all secondary sources. If the result is subject to an official La Liga or RFEF review, resolution is deferred until the ratified outcome is confirmed.
